SUPPLIES:
Minc ready scrapbooking paper. (you can find the Minc machine and supplies at Joann, Hobby Lobby and even some local craft stores)
Composition Notebook
Glue Stick or Modge Podge
Decorative Minc Elements or clipart printed from a toner based printer.
First I decided what paper I wanted on my composition notebook and cut it to match the size of my notebook.
I then placed the paper with the foil on top of the paperin the clear applicator sleeve and ran it through the Minc Machine at the heat level of 2.
You can either use a glue stick to attach your foiled paper to the notebook or Modge Podge would work as well you will just have to let it dry in between your layers. Modge Podge will definitely allow your notebook to last longer.
I ran my other design elements through the Minc Machine with some coordinating colors and attached them to my notebook.
